(3)指定位置讓茶壺旋轉
前面茶壺勾著後面茶壺旋轉
程式碼:
#include <GL/glut.h>
float rot1=0;
void display()
{
glClear(GL_COLOR_BUFFER_BIT|GL_DEPTH_BUFFER_BIT);
glPushMatrix();
glutSolidTeapot(0.2);
glTranslatef(0.33,0.05,0);///Step 3:let below 1-2 to be in (0.5,0.5);
glRotatef(rot1,0,0,1);///Step 1:prepare rotate
glTranslatef(0.25,0,0);///Step 2:let the teapot handle be rotating center
glutSolidTeapot(0.2);
glTranslatef(0.33,0.05,0);///Step 3:let below 1-2 to be in (0.5,0.5);
glRotatef(rot1,0,0,1);///Step 1:prepare rotate
glTranslatef(0.25,0,0);///Step 2:let the teapot handle be rotating center
glutSolidTeapot(0.2);
glPopMatrix();
glutSwapBuffers();
}
void motion(int x,int y)
{
rot1=x;
glutPostRedisplay();
}
int main(int argc,char**argv)
{
glutInit(&argc,argv);
glutInitDisplayMode(GLUT_DOUBLE|GLUT_DEPTH);
glutCreateWindow("Robot");
glutDisplayFunc(display);
glutMotionFunc(motion);
glutMainLoop();
}

(5)機器人可以動手臂
加入旋轉,手臂可以動了
程式碼:
#include <GL/glut.h>
float rot1=0;
void display()
{
glClear(GL_COLOR_BUFFER_BIT|GL_DEPTH_BUFFER_BIT);
glPushMatrix();
glutWireCube(0.3);///body
glPushMatrix();
glTranslatef(0,0.2,0);
glutWireCube(0.1);///head
glPopMatrix();
glPushMatrix();
glTranslatef(0.15,0.1,0);
glRotatef(rot1,0,0,1);
glTranslatef(0.05,0,0);
glutWireCube(0.1);///upper arm
glTranslatef(0.05,0,0);
glRotatef(rot1,0,0,1);
glTranslatef(0.05,0,0);
glutWireCube(0.1);///lower arm
glTranslatef(0.05,0,0);
glRotatef(rot1,0,0,1);
glTranslatef(0.05,0,0);
glutWireCube(0.1);///right hand
glPopMatrix();
glPushMatrix();
///glTranslatef(-0.2,0.1,0);
glTranslatef(-0.15,0.1,0);
glRotatef(-rot1,0,0,1);
glTranslatef(-0.05,0,0);
glutWireCube(0.1);///upper arm
///glTranslatef(-0.1,0,0);
glTranslatef(-0.05,0,0);
glRotatef(-rot1,0,0,1);
glTranslatef(-0.05,0,0);
glutWireCube(0.1);///lower arm
///glTranslatef(-0.1,0,0);
glTranslatef(-0.05,0,0);
glRotatef(-rot1,0,0,1);
glTranslatef(-0.05,0,0);
glutWireCube(0.1);///right hand
glPopMatrix();
glPopMatrix();
glutSwapBuffers();
}
void motion(int x,int y)
{
rot1=x;
glutPostRedisplay();
}
int main(int argc,char**argv)
{
glutInit(&argc,argv);
glutInitDisplayMode(GLUT_DOUBLE|GLUT_DEPTH);
glutCreateWindow("Robot");
glutDisplayFunc(display);
glutMotionFunc(motion);
glutMainLoop();
}
